We are looking for a driven and curious Associate Civil Engineer to support our federal team in a hybrid capacity at our Boston office.

As a key member of our team, you’ll join our collaborative process providing our clients with award-winning planning, engineering, architectural design, construction management, and design-build project delivery. The ideal candidate is one who is passionate about civil site design, as well as Civil Works projects that address our country’s water, resiliency, and disaster recovery challenges through measures such as floodwalls and stormwater pump stations. You’ll have the opportunity to work in a team environment and coordinate project assignments with other engineers and technicians in and out of your discipline group, as well as with clients and end users in Federal Civilian and Department of Defense (DoD) government agencies. Responsibilities include:

  • Act as lead project engineer for specific tasks within large, complex projects. Act as Engineer of Record on projects scoped specifically within area of expertise and experience
  • Plan and execute work independently while performing non-routine and complex assignments based on high-level instructions
  • Work closely with multi-disciplinary design teams and project managers
  • Research, interpret, and implement regulatory code requirements and design standards
  • Prepare engineering assessment reports and design documents, including plans, specifications, calculations, and basis of design reports
  • Provide technical guidance, coaching, and mentorship to technicians and less experienced engineers
  • Analyze sketches, notes and other input material to determine and plan the best approach to develop designs with minimal supervision
  • Continually develop skills by being proactive in advancing your own workflows, systems, tools, and communication techniques
  • Occasionally travel to project and client sites for observations, meetings, and presentations

Here's what you'll need

  • Bachelors Degree in Civil Engineering
  • Registration as a Professional Engineer (PE) in at least one state
  • At least 8 years of experience with civil site development projects and/or civil works infrastructure projects
  • Detailed knowledge of civil site and infrastructure design, including site layout, pavements, grading, utilities, drainage, stormwater management and erosion & sediment control. Experience with H&H modeling software is a plus
  • Basic knowledge of architecture and related engineering disciplines
  • Attention to detail and commitment to quality
  • Familiarity with applicable federal codes and standards, including Unified Facilities Criteria (UFCs)
  • United States Citizenship
  • Expertise with AutoCAD Civil 3D design software
